A nurse is caring for a client who is postoperative following cataract surgery. Which of the following actions should the nurse take?
Correct Answer: B
Rationale: The correct answer is B: Administer eye drops as prescribed. This is important to prevent infection, reduce inflammation, and promote healing post cataract surgery. Eye drops help keep the eye lubricated and aid in recovery. Sleeping on the operative side (
A) should be avoided to prevent pressure on the eye. Reading small print (
C) can strain the eyes post-surgery. Bending at the waist (
D) can increase intraocular pressure and should be avoided to prevent complications.
